DeleteSegment

Top  Previous  Next

 

Löschen einer Ebene mit Inhalt.

Moskito organisiert seine geographischen Daten in Ebene und innerhalb dieser Ebenen in Plänen. Es gibt vom Anwender geladene Ebenen, etwa eine Ebene mit der Nummer 150, in dem die Normalen Pläne vorhanden  sind, und Ebenen mit Daten, die von Moskito implizit angelegt werden, etwa die Ebene ZEICHENSEGMENT, in dem das Aussehen der Textcharacter gespeichert ist. Unter Umständen ist es notwendig, eine Ebene vollständig zu entfernen, z.B. wenn alle Pläne aus einer Ebene nicht mehr bearbeitet werden sollen ohne mit New das gesamte Workfile neu aufzubauen.

DeleteSegment entfernt eine einzelne Ebene aus dem Workfile. Dies kann auch eines der von Moskito angelegten sein. Wenn die Ebene nach dem letzten Sichern geändert wurde, wird abgefragt, ob die Ebene wirklich gelöscht werden soll.

Voraussetzung

Parameter

<Segmentnummer>

Die Nummer der Ebene muß als Parameter übergaben werden. Die Ebene wird ohne Rückfrage entfernt.

<Segmentname>

Statt der Nummer einer der impliziten Ebenen kann der Name dieser Ebene angegeben werden. Die Prozedur versteht die Namen ZEICHEN und SYMBOL für die Ebenen mit dem Aussehen der Textcharacter und für die Symboltabelle.

Wird das ZEICHEN-Segment gelöscht, dann erfolgen alle Textausgaben mit dem Systemfont.

Wird die Symbolebene gelöscht, werden die Symbole nicht mehr dargestellt. Die Symbolelemente selbst werden nicht verändert und können z.B. durch IdentifyElement gefunden werden.

Rückgabewert

Wert

Beschreibung

0

Aufruf wurde erfolgreich durchgeführt

sonst

Fehler aufgetreten

Dialog

Beispiel

Bemerkung

Siehe auch